New council members sworn in for Rapid City Monday

RAPID CITY, S.D. – At Monday night’s meeting of the Rapid City Council, five individuals were sworn in for new three-year terms. Each member of the group was elected at last month’s municipal election and includes newcomers Stephen Tamang and Callie Meyer.

Finance Director Daniel Ainslie administered the oaths of office to Tamang (Ward One), Bill Evans (Ward Two), Greg Strommen (Ward Three), Lance Lehmann (Ward Four) and Meyer (Ward Five). They join Josh Biberdorf (Ward One), Lindsey Seachris (Ward Two), Kevin Maher (Ward Three), John Roberts (Ward Four) and Rod Pettigrew (Ward Five), who enter the new term with one year remaining in their current three-year terms.

The first order of business for the newly-seated Council was the election of the Council president and vice president for the next year. Pettigrew, who has served on the City Council since 2023, was elected president and Bill Evans, a member of the Council since 2019, was elected vice president for the 2025-26 Council term.

Mayor Jason Salamun also recognized departing Council members Pat Roseland and Jesse Ham for their service to the City Council and Rapid City community.
